Joseph LETOURNEAU was born 16 August 1726 in Sainte-Famille-de-l'île-d'Orléans, Canada, New France
Joseph LETOURNEAU was the child of Jean LÉTOURNEAU and Marguerite CARON and the grandchild of: (paternal) David LÉTOURNEAU and Françoise CHAPELAIN (maternal) Robert CARON and Marguerite CLOUTIERS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Joseph married Madeleine MONTIGNY 14 February 1752 in Saint-Pierre-de-l'Île-d'Orléans,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Madeleine MONTIGNY was born 14 February 1731 in Saint-Pierre-de-l'Île-d'Orléans, Québec, Canada. Madeleine died 2 April 1807 in L'Acadie,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Marguerite-de-Blairfindie). Madeleine was the child of Pierre-Michel MONTIGNY and Madeleine FERLAND.
Joseph LETOURNEAU died 17 August 1807 in L'Acadie, Lower Canada .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
